Procedure 7.2 - Replacing a Display Enclosure or Upper PCA
Procedure
Anti-static kits (part number 20024-101) can be ordered from Precor.
The keyboard is part of the display housing front panel. If the keyboard is not functioning
properly, replace the display housing front panel.
Removing the Display Housing Front Panel
1. Set the on/off switch in the “off” position.
WARNING
Before continuing with this procedure, review the Warning and Caution statements listed in
Section One, Things You Should Know.
2. Attach the anti-static wrist strap to your arm, then connect the ground lead of the wrist strap
to the units frame.
3. Remove the four screws that secure the display housing front panel to the display backing
plate.
4. Disconnect the upper interconnect cable (J5) and the heart rate cable (J1) from the upper
PCA.
Removing and Replacing the Upper PCA
5. Carefully disconnect the keyboard cable from the upper PCA (connector J2).
6. Remove the four screws that secure the upper PCA to the display housing front panel.
Note:
Package the upper PCA in an anti-static bag and document the problem as described in
Procedure 2.4, Documenting Software Problems.
